Aplos River is a broad, slow-moving river originating from somewhere beneath the mountains of Spirane and feeding Iromar’s moors in the south. The northern parts of the river are known for their strong currents, with the water becoming slow moving in the south. The riverbanks vary along its course, ranging from soft hummock grasses to small groups of pine, and sometimes nothing but pebbles and sand. Crossing can be difficult at times, but it can be swam or bridged by fallen trees or boulders alike.

The small gathering at the lip of the pit had proved to be as fruitless as her encounter with Leviathan. There had been one who had seemed interested in speaking with Elowen, but she had politely said her hello and then left in her characteristically nonchalant manner. Crowds did not suit her, and so she slipped away from the splashing and the introductions to slink across to the opposite side of the crater from where she had started.

The landscape was different here; rather than steep rocks and overhangs boasting waterfalls, there was grass that in the summer would be lush and soft, with a river slicing it in two. The trees were sparse, but in warmer months the grass would provide adequate cover. At the moment, it was shriveled and brown, causing her footsteps to be audible whispers when the wind did not sweep the sound away. Though she stepped as lightly as possible, Elowen knew that if anyone were in the area, they would detect her no matter how silently she made her way. Her scent would carry on the autumn breeze to the noses of the hidden.

A sudden howl caused her to defensively press herself lower to the ground. She glanced from side to side, and inhaled deeply, but could not detect anyone. Upwind. Turning, she cautiously crept through the dry field. Whereas she was well-camouflaged in the western portion of this place, here her mottled grey coat stood out against the background, though perhaps not quite like that of the black figure that finally entered her vision up ahead.

He seemed relaxed, though Elowen knew better than to let her guard down. Keeping herself tense and ready for a fight (or flight) if need be, she stood a little taller than before as she walked toward the stranger. It was rather unlike her to seek out a conversation, but she wished to know who would be so dense as to actually attract potentially unwanted attention to himself.

About ten feet away from the black male, she stopped. Elowen held her head low, with her ears angled back a bit in a rather defensive stance. However, her face held only curiosity. Her navy-rimmed green eyes looked straight into his; they were of a similar color. As she stood staring, she tried to read his intentions, but years of self-inflicted isolation made her a rather poor judge of such things. To further illustrate her social ineptitude, she kept silent for several moments and waited for him to speak first.
